Selank is a synthetic heptapeptide developed at the Institute of Molecular Genetics of the Russian Academy of Sciences. It is a derivative of the naturally occurring immunomodulatory peptide tuftsin (Thr-Lys-Pro-Arg), with an additional Pro-Gly-Pro sequence that enhances stability and adds unique biological properties. - Molecular Weight: 751 Da - Amino Acid Sequence: Thr-Lys-Pro-Arg-Pro-Gly-Pro (TKPRPGP) - Structural Basis: Tuftsin analog with C-terminal extension - Solubility: Water-soluble - Stability: Enhanced compared to native tuftsin due to Pro-Gly-Pro addition Selank exhibits a multi-faceted mechanism involving several neurotransmitter systems: - GABA-A Modulation: Allosteric modulation of GABA receptors - Benzodiazepine Site Interaction: May act at benzodiazepine binding sites - Distinct from BZD: Does not produce sedation or dependence p
